Police: Naugatuck Man Drove His Car Toward His Wife

Police say the incident occurred on Andrew Mountain Road.

A scary incident allegedly occurred on Andrew Mountain Road on Friday.

Police say officers responded to the area on a report of a domestic disturbance between husband and wife.

During an argument, in the driveway, the accused, Jason Lapan, 32, of Andrew Mountain Road, allegedly drove his vehicle toward the victim, police said.

He returned later and a second argument ensued.

During the argument Lapan allegedly attempted to take the victim’s phone while she was calling police, police said.

Lapan was released after posting $25,000 bond. He was charged with disorderly conduct, third-degree assault, threatening, first-degree reckless endangerment, and interfering with an emergency call.
